The Impact Of Background Apps

Background apps are notorious for silently draining your Surface battery without you even realizing it. These apps continue to run in the background even when you’re not actively using them, consuming precious energy and reducing your device’s battery life. From communication apps to system utilities, each background app contributes to the overall drain on your battery.

To prevent excessive battery drain from background apps, it’s essential to regularly review and manage which apps are allowed to run in the background. By disabling unnecessary background apps or adjusting their settings to limit their background activity, you can significantly improve your Surface’s battery performance. Additionally, being mindful of the number of apps running in the background and closing those you don’t need can help extend your battery life and optimize your device’s efficiency.

Overuse Of Power-Hungry Features

To maximize the battery life of your Surface device, it’s crucial to consider the impact of power-hungry features on energy consumption. Features like high screen brightness, background app refresh, GPS, and Bluetooth can drain your battery significantly faster. Running multiple applications simultaneously, especially those that demand heavy processing power, also accelerates battery depletion.

Streaming high-definition videos, playing graphic-intensive games, or using applications that require constant internet connectivity can put a strain on your Surface battery. Furthermore, enabling features like push notifications and location services for a multitude of apps can lead to excessive power consumption. To prolong battery life, it’s essential to identify and limit the usage of these power-hungry features when not needed.

By understanding how power-hungry features impact your Surface device’s battery life, you can make conscious choices to preserve energy. Adjusting settings to optimize power usage, closing unnecessary applications running in the background, and reducing screen brightness are simple yet effective ways to mitigate the overuse of power-hungry features and extend the uptime of your Surface device.

Aging Battery And Its Effects

As your Surface device ages, the battery undergoes natural wear and tear, leading to a decrease in its overall capacity. This reduction in battery capacity means that the device will not hold a charge for as long as it used to when it was new. The aging process also affects the battery’s ability to provide consistent power output, resulting in faster drainage during usage.

Furthermore, an aging battery may struggle to maintain a stable voltage level, causing fluctuations in power supply to the device. This instability can put additional strain on the system components, leading to increased power consumption and faster battery depletion. To mitigate the effects of an aging battery, users can consider recalibrating the battery, reducing background processes, or even replacing the battery if necessary.

Signal Strength And Battery Usage

Signal strength plays a significant role in determining how quickly your Surface battery drains. When your device struggles to maintain a strong signal, it expends more energy searching for and staying connected to the network. This constant search and connection maintenance can lead to a faster depletion of your battery life.

Weak signal areas or being far from cell towers can force your Surface to boost its signal transmission power, consuming more battery in the process. Additionally, fluctuating signal strength can cause your device to continuously switch between different towers, further draining its battery. To improve battery life in such scenarios, consider using Wi-Fi whenever possible or enabling airplane mode in areas with poor network coverage.

Faulty Charging Equipment

Faulty charging equipment can significantly contribute to the rapid draining of your Surface battery. When your charging cable, power adapter, or charging port is malfunctioning, it may not deliver the required power to effectively charge your device. This can result in incomplete charging cycles, leading to a shorter battery life on your Surface.

Common signs of faulty charging equipment include slow charging times, inconsistent charging, or the inability to charge at all. If you notice any of these issues, it is crucial to address them promptly to prevent further damage to your Surface battery. Investing in high-quality charging accessories and ensuring they are in good working condition can help prolong the lifespan of your device’s battery and improve its overall performance.

Regularly inspecting your charging equipment for wear and tear, cleaning the charging port to remove dirt and debris, and using certified chargers recommended by the manufacturer can all help prevent issues related to faulty charging equipment and preserve the battery life of your Surface device.

Tips For Prolonging Surface Battery Life

To prolong your Surface battery life, always adjust your power settings to optimize energy usage. Lowering screen brightness, disabling unused apps, and activating battery saver mode can significantly extend your device’s runtime. Additionally, managing background processes and updating software regularly can help improve battery efficiency.

Furthermore, utilizing sleep or hibernation mode when not actively using your Surface can prevent unnecessary power consumption. Unplugging peripherals like USB devices and external drives when not in use can also conserve battery. Consider investing in a quality charger and avoid overcharging your device to prevent battery degradation over time.

Lastly, being mindful of temperature extremes can impact battery performance. Avoid exposing your Surface to extreme heat or cold, as this can affect battery health. Is It Normal For A Surface Device’S Battery Life To Decrease Over Time, And If So, Why Does This Happen?

Yes, it is normal for a Surface device’s battery life to decrease over time. This happens due to several factors, including the number of charge cycles the battery has gone through, exposure to heat, and overall age of the device. As the battery ages, its ability to hold a charge diminishes, leading to a shorter runtime between charges. Regularly calibrating the battery and avoiding extreme temperatures can help prolong the battery life of a Surface device.
